Neo Sports announces largest line up of broadcast sponsors

By Staff

Mumbai, Sep 28 (UNI) Neo Sports today announced the largest ever line up of broadcast sponsors in India commencing with the seven-match ''Future Cup'' India versus Australia ODI series starting tomorrow.

The co-presenting broadcast sponsors of this Series are Hero Honda, Future Group, Reliance Mobile and Pidilite. The associate broadcast sponsors are LG, Intel, Perfetti and S Kumars.

The line up marks the re-entry of LG as a broadcast sponsor of cricket and the significantly enhanced commitments of Pidilite, Intel and S Kumars, a release issued here today stated.

Commenting on the deals, Sunil Manocha, Sr. VP Advertising Revenue of Neo Sports said, ''The enormous fragmentation in the general entertainment space combined with the massive surge in cricket ratings have led to a new high in demand for advertising on both international and domestic cricket leading Neo Sports to an unprecedented level of on-air deals well ahead of the commencement of the home season.'' The Future Cup India versus Australia line up has already been bettered with advertisers signing up for the Nov-Dec 2007 India versus Pakistan Test and ODI Series where as many as 10 broadcast sponsors have already been signed with two more expected to close next month creating a record high for televised cricket in India.

The line up consists of co-presenting sponsors Hero Honda, Future Group, Reliance Mobile and Pidilite; the associate sponsors are LG, S Kumar, HDFC Standard Life Insurance, Ultratech and INX Media. The arrival of INX Media represents the strengthening of an emerging trend in on-air advertising through cricket wherein new sectors are beginning to commit their spend to cricket, the only media vehicle that delivers a pan-Indian audience, emotional connect and the highest break viewership for any TV program, the release further stated.

Both Series will have Ambuja Cement as the action replay sponsor and Philips as a sponsor of wrap around programming.

For the first time ever a sports channel has signed a data sponsor in the form of Standard Chartered which will be the data sponsor for both Series, the release added.
